AI Integration Framework

How We Embed AI into Business Operations Without Disrupting Existing Systems

Quokka Labs delivers AI integration services through an architecture-led framework that aligns business processes, applications, and operational workflows to embed AI without disrupting existing systems.

1

Workflow and System Discovery

We identify the business workflows, user interactions, applications, data sources, APIs, and operational dependencies involved in the integration. The assessment defines expected outcomes, system constraints, security boundaries, latency requirements, and measurable success criteria.

2

Integration Architecture and Contracts

Our architects define the target integration model using API-led, event-driven, batch, streaming, or hybrid patterns. We establish interface contracts, schemas, model gateways, identity flows, error-handling rules, and deployment boundaries before engineering begins.

3

Data, Context and Connector Engineering

We build secure connectors for databases, SaaS platforms, document systems, APIs, event streams, and legacy applications. Data transformation, validation, permission propagation, context enrichment, and synchronization ensure AI receives current and governed information.

4

AI Orchestration and Application Integration

Models, agents, tools, business rules, and human approvals are integrated into the target application or workflow. We implement state management, structured outputs, routing, retries, fallback logic, and exception handling for controlled execution across connected systems.

5

Security, Resilience and Integration Validation

The integration is validated for authentication, authorization, data exposure, schema compatibility, model behaviour, latency, throughput, and failure recovery. Contract testing, circuit breakers, idempotency, audit trails, and rollback controls reduce production risk.

6

Controlled Deployment and Runtime Optimization

We release AI integrations through phased deployment, feature controls, observability, and production monitoring. Distributed tracing, API health metrics, workflow diagnostics, model usage, cost monitoring, and SLO tracking support reliable long-term operations.

What is the difference between AI integration and AI implementation?

AI implementation focuses on developing or deploying AI models and capabilities. AI integration focuses on connecting those AI capabilities with business applications, enterprise data, APIs, and operational workflows so AI can deliver measurable value within existing business processes.

What is the role of Retrieval-Augmented Generation (RAG) in AI integration?

Retrieval-Augmented Generation (RAG) connects AI models with enterprise knowledge repositories, business documents, and operational data through retrieval pipelines and vector databases. This improves response accuracy, contextual relevance, and decision support without retraining foundation models.
